About Queens County, New York
Queens is a borough of New York City, coextensive with Queens County, in the U.S. state of New York. Located on Long Island, it is the largest borough of New York City in area; it is bordered by the borough of Brooklyn at the western tip of Long Island to its west and Nassau County to the east. Queens also shares water borders with the boroughs of Manhattan, the Bronx, and Staten Island (via the Rockaways).

Transportation Hubs
Queens boasts both of the city's major airports, LaGuardia and John F. Kennedy International, ensuring easy travel access.
Attractions and Cultural Hotspots
- Beaches and Parks: Queens offers beautiful beaches like Jacob Riis Park and Rockaway Beach, providing perfect escapes for relaxation and ocean views.
- Historical and Cultural Sites: Visit the Louis Armstrong House in Corona, explore modern art at the Museum of Modern Art's PS1, or enjoy the Museum of the Moving Image in Astoria.
Cultural Diversity
Queens is renowned for its multicultural and multilingual community, making it a vibrant tapestry of cultures. Known as the "language capital of the world," the borough is home to speakers of over 160 different languages. It boasts a thriving Chinatown, surpassing even Manhattan's in population, offering unique Asian markets and culinary experiences.
Economic Insights
While the cost of public transit and sales tax are consistent throughout NYC, Queens stands out with more affordable housing. Rent here is about 30% cheaper than in Manhattan, with average costs for a one-bedroom apartment around $2,200 compared to Manhattan's $3,100.
